,31-year-old DJ Ferguson who is in critical need of a heart transplant has been refused due to his unacceptance of the Covid vaccine.

According to BBC News, the US hospital, Bringham and Women’s Hospital took him off the list because, according to his father David, the COVID-19 vaccines go against his beliefs.
The hospital, claims that because of the scarcity of organs, they have to make sure that patients who would be getting a transplant will have a greater chance of survival after the surgery.
A spokesperson for the hospital reported that there was a need to look into the lifestyle and Covid vaccination of patients to ensure the best transplant results.

The immune system of a patient who has gone through the procedure is usually severely low and not taking the Covid vaccine would not give such patients the best chance of survival.
Although the hospital had other reasons the patient was denied a transplant, these were not divulged due to confidentiality.
The hospital admitted that a hundred thousand people would have to be put on the waiting list for the next five years due to the scarcity of organs.
Ferguson on his part had not accepted the vaccine because he suffered from a hereditary disease of the heart that pools blood in his lungs.

He had feared that he might have experienced cardiac inflammation which happens to be a rare side effect of the Covid vaccination.
However, US Centres for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) debunked the likeliness of having such side effects and emphasised the temporariness of such disease.
Hence, CDC endorses transplant patients to get full vaccination and boosters for the sake of their health.
